What Is GIC Canada for International Students?

GIC, short for Guaranteed Investment Certificate, is a Canadian investment for international students for a fixed period. It has a guaranteed return attached to it. 

To qualify for a Canadian study permit or study visa, you must have enough funds to support your stay for at least a year and demonstrate proof of the same. They must deposit this money with a Canadian banking institution and avail a GIC from them.

Important Things About Use of GIC Canada For International Students 

If you are opening a GIC account, you must keep certain things in mind. These are some factors you should be well-versed in before you consider opening a GIC account. 

  • You should choose a Canadian banking institution that offers GIC and also meets the SDS requirements and standards 

  • You cannot access your GIC account unless you are in Canada. So you must arrive in Canada first to access your GIC account

  • You will have to go through an identity check before being able to access your account 

  • When you access your money, the Canadian institution will release it in two phases - an initial lump sum amount at first and monthly installments over a year

How To Open An Account for GIC Canada For International Students?

Now that we have answered your first question- “What is GIC Canada for International students?” we will answer your second most important question- how do you open this account? 

Follow these simple steps to open a GIC account. 

Step 1: Register with one of the financial institutions that offer GIC accounts. You can open an account online itself. 

Step 2: Sign up for a GIC account. Fill out the application and upload all the important documents. Be very mindful while submitting your information and do not make any mistakes. 

Step 3: Transfer 20,635 CAD (12,71,619 INR) to your GIC account. This is the recommended minimum balance for GIC amount in Canada for international students. You cannot go below it. 

Step 4: Once you open your account and transfer the money, you’re almost done! You will soon receive the certificate, which is the GIC Canada for international students. Your financial institution might also give you some documents like a letter of attestation or a confirmation of your investment balance. 

Step 5: Once you reach Canada, make it a priority to visit your financial institution first. Visit the branch, get your identity verified in person and then you will be able to access your GIC account. 

Types Of GIC Canada For International Students 

There are three different types of GICs that you can open. The use of GIC Canada for international students is different, based on what type of GIC they issue. They are listed below. 

  • Cashable GIC: This does not have a fund lock-in period. You can withdraw your money at any time from this GIC. The use of GIC Canada for international students through the cashable GIC is best for short-term investments. However, this GIC does have a monthly limit on withdrawals. 

  • Non-Cashable GIC: The use of GIC Canada for international students can through this one is best for individuals who wish for a long-term investment. You cannot access your funds until they mature. The rate of return is quite high. 

  • Market Growth GIC: The return rate of GIC amount in Canada for international students differs based on market performance. In this GIC, you can get a minimum guaranteed return as well as an expected profit based on the market performance.

What Is GIC amount in Canada for international students?

The GIC amount is 20,635 CAD (12,71,619 INR). It used to be 10,000 CAD but then was amended by the Canadian government in January 2024.

What documents are required for GIC Canada for international students?

You need a copy of your passport, your PAN Card, acceptance letter, and proof of enrollment from the university.

What is the interest rate of GIC?

The rate difference from bank to bank. ICICI Bank offers 1 percent, SBI offers 1.05 percent and Scotia Bank offers somewhere between 0.1 to 1 percent.

What is the Student Direct Stream (SDS) program?

The SDS is a process that allows faster processing of student visa applications for Canada. Only certain countries can use the SDS program for faster visa processing. India is one of them.
